
PLDA USB 3.0 Device Controller is a high performance, low gate count semiconductor IP that adds SuperSpeed USB device connectivity to Xilinx FPGAs. The controller implements all of the digital layers defined by the USB 3.0 Specification and is fully backward compatible with USB 2.0.

IP Features and Deliverables
- USB 3.0 Device IP core in synthezisable Verilog RTL (encrypted or source code)
- Includes Physical, Link, and Protocol layers
- Includes Device Controller
- Complies to the USB 3.0 Specification, revision 1.0
- Full support for legacy USB 2.0
- Core frequency: 62.5 Mhz
- USB 3.0 PIPE interface (16-bit)
- USB 2.0 ULPI interface
- Full Power Management support (U1,U2,U3)
- Up to 16 IN and OUT endpoints
- USB 3.0 Device IP simulation models
- Interface to TI's TUSB1310
- USB 3.0 Testbench simulation libraries
- Reference design: Mass Storage Class Device
- Synthesizable Verilog RTL source code
- Simulation environment
- FPGA synthesis and Place-and-Route environment
- Complete documentation
